Transaction 3b7505fec7b37fc57607ae3db8d2d1cf63f6f3f19f1d4ca1466d2189c544829f
4 Input
2 Outputs
- 3b7505fec7b37fc57607ae3db8d2d1cf63f6f3f19f1d4ca1466d2189c544829f:0
- 3b7505fec7b37fc57607ae3db8d2d1cf63f6f3f19f1d4ca1466d2189c544829f:1
value 13487629
address 1L8LSpcKxuomsJyFnUXTewyNUptLJPYf98
value 117454
address 13jLf3SaEimFVLnQHR1BsMoDZRAvL8NGZ3